10. Side effects such as drowsiness, mental clouding, and nausea can be a result of taking:
Tranquilizers
Pain Relievers
NarcoticS
O Stimulants

Answers

Answer:

Narcotics

Explanation:

What usually produces the mentioned side effects is:

Narcotics

Narcotics.

This type of medicine, also called opiate, is a strong medicine used for many types of pain when other medicines cannot control it, its consumption is controlled by law since it has various side effects.

Among its side effects that can be mentioned are drowsiness, dizziness, confusion, constipation or even vomiting and nausea.

Which of these statements best describes the use of facial expressions in ASL?

Answers

In American Sign Language, facial expressions are an important part of communication.
The facial expressions you use while doing a sign will affect the meaning of that sign.
For example, if you sign the word "quiet," and add an exaggerated or intense facial expression, you are telling your audience to be "very quiet."
This principle also works when making "interesting" into "very interesting," or "funny" into "very funny."
Facial expressions are an example of a set of behaviors called "non-manual markers." Non-manual markers include facial expressions, head tilt, head nod, head shake, shoulder raising, mouth morphemes, and other non-signed signals that influence the meaning of your signs.

(02.01 LC)
The Braidwoods' refusal to share their oral communication led to
A.) an acceptance of lip reading in American schools
B.) collaboration between Gallaudet and Clerc
C.) Cogswell sending Gallaudet to England
D.) the development of a Paris school for the Deaf

Answers

Answer:

B.) collaboration between Gallaudet and Clerc

Explanation:

Historical sources say that because the Braldwood's refused to share their sign language teaching methods, this led to a collaboration between Thomas Hopkins Gallaudet, an Ameican, and Laurent Clerc, a French man.

This collaboration led to the first permanent school for the deaf to be opened in the United States.
